
WeatherNext Hurricane Prediction Adds a Day of Warning Lead Time
Published by AINave Editorial • Reviewed by Ramit
Google DeepMind and Google Research's WeatherNext model is designed to improve both hurricane track and intensity forecasts. In the reported case of Hurricane Melissa, it predicted a Category 5 landfall in Jamaica five days ahead with 80 percent confidence, giving forecasters roughly one additional day of useful lead time compared with existing models. For emergency teams, that can mean more time to organize evacuations, stage supplies, and move response resources. The reported Hurricane Melissa Jamaica landfall forecast is a concrete example, not proof that every storm will receive the same warning advantage.
WeatherNext combines track, intensity, and uncertainty
The technical distinction matters. A storm's track depends on large-scale atmospheric conditions, while intensity depends on more local ocean and atmospheric signals. Earlier AI systems were generally stronger at track prediction than at estimating whether a storm would rapidly intensify. WeatherNext reportedly handles both using relatively coarse-resolution inputs, although even its researchers do not fully understand which signals the model is extracting.
Instead of producing one deterministic path, the system generates a range of possible storm evolutions. It can now produce up to 1,000 scenarios per storm, compared with 50 previously. That makes its weather AI scenario outputs useful for reasoning about uncertainty and small changes that may create much larger downstream effects.

An extra day changes operational decisions
A three-day forecast reaching the accuracy of older two-day forecasts can shift when agencies begin acting. Evacuation planning, shelter preparation, fuel staging, and communications all become easier when officials have more reliable notice. The model's value therefore comes from decision lead time, not from making a forecast look impressive on a benchmark.
For product teams building AI-assisted forecasting systems, the operational workflow is the important model. WeatherNext is used alongside other forecasting tools, and forecasters translate track and intensity estimates into likely local impacts. A model can identify a dangerous scenario, but it cannot by itself determine which communities need to move, how roads will flood, or how residents will respond.
Open sourcing creates a path to validation
Google DeepMind announced that it would open-source the WeatherNext models used during hurricane season. That could help researchers reproduce results, examine the model's behavior, and investigate why lower-resolution inputs appear to contain useful intensity signals.
The release also creates a test for the broader claim. Independent evaluation across more storms and seasons matters more than one successful event. Builders should distinguish the reported Melissa result from a general guarantee, and they should treat the model as a decision-support component until operational validation establishes where it performs reliably.
